> On 2020 Dec  1, at 21:04, Chris Lattner <clattner at nondot.org> wrote:
>
> 1) are you, or anyone else, interested in driving an llvm::Vector proposal
> + coding standard change to get us going in the right direction?  I don’t
> think we need a mass migration of the code base, just get the policy
> aligned right plus the new type name to exist.
>
>
> I'll try to get a minimal patch together with docs and send an RFC later
> this week.
>
> (
> I think the initial patch could be as simple as:
> ```
> template <class T> using Vector = SmallVector<T, 0>;
> ```
> but maybe we'd want to rename `SmallVectorImpl` to `VectorImpl`, or maybe
> there are other ideas, but off topic for this thread...
> )
>
>
> Right, I think it is as simple as the using declaration, but also includes
> a revision to the coding standards and programmer manual dox.
>
> I do think that renaming SmallVectorImpl to VectorImpl would make sense,
> that is something we can stage in over time (introduce the alternate name,
> rename everything in tree, then drop the old name in a few months).
>

And we can drop the "Impl", since it is a type intended to be used by users
:)
